Plant onion sets directly in well-prepared soil with the pointed end facing upward. Place bulbs shallowly so the tip remains slightly above soil level. Maintain proper spacing to allow bulb expansion.

Water moderately to keep soil moist but not waterlogged. Provide full sunlight and remove weeds regularly to ensure healthy bulb development and maximum yield.

How can mixed onion sets be organized in a vegetable bed?

Plant yellow, red, and white sets in separate short rows or labeled sections. This makes harvesting and storing different onion types easier to manage.

Can onion sets be planted between other vegetables?

Yes. They can fit into mixed vegetable beds when given sufficient spacing and sunlight. Avoid overcrowding plants that require much more room.

How can I tell when onions are approaching harvest?

As bulbs mature, the green tops often begin to yellow and bend over naturally. This change can help indicate that the bulbs are nearing harvest.

Why should onions be cured after lifting?

Curing allows the outer layers and necks to dry, which improves storage readiness. Place harvested onions in a dry, airy location away from excessive moisture.

Can yellow, red, and white onions be stored together?

They can be kept in the same general storage area if conditions are dry and well ventilated, but sort out damaged or soft bulbs before long-term storage.

How can I avoid misshapen onion bulbs?

Provide consistent moisture, suitable spacing, and loose soil so developing bulbs have room to expand without excessive competition or compaction.
